(1):

(a.) Having the property of transmitting rays of light, so that bodies can be distinctly seen through; pervious to light; diaphanous; pellucid; as, transparent glass; a transparent diamond; - opposed to opaque.

(2):

(a.) Admitting the passage of light; open; porous; as, a transparent veil.
